Use slides and visual aids to explain complex systems logically.
In technical presentations, engineers utilize slides and visual aids to make complex systems understandable to their audience. This approach not only helps to illustrate the technical aspects but also keeps the audience engaged. It's essential to present the information in a logical sequence so that listeners can follow easily. For instance, starting with an overview before diving into detailed explanations can frame the discussion effectively.
Think of a chef explaining a complicated recipe to a group of aspiring cooks. Instead of just listing ingredients, the chef might use images of each dish, step-by-step visuals, and demonstrations to ensure that everyone can grasp the cooking process. This visual information helps everyone to understand the cooking techniques better, just as slides help in technical presentations.

Clearly present objectives, decisions, and supporting data.
During design reviews, it is crucial to communicate the objectives of the project and the decisions taken throughout the design process. This often includes the rationale for choices made and supporting data that validates these decisions. Presenting clear, concise objectives ensures that all stakeholders are aligned and understand the purpose of the review. This transparency allows for more effective feedback and collaboration among team members.
Consider a basketball coach going over game strategies with players. The coach presents the objectives of each play, explains the decisions behind them, and uses past game data to back up these strategies. Just like in design reviews, this clear communication helps players understand their roles and the overall game plan.

Report progress, blockers, and coordinate across functions.
In team meetings, engineers report on their progress, discuss any blockers they are facing, and coordinate efforts across different functions. This practice is vital for identifying issues early and fostering collaboration among team members. Clear communication helps ensure that everyone is on the same page and aware of each otherβs challenges, leading to more effective problem-solving.
Imagine a group of students working on a school project. In their meetings, each student shares what tasks they've completed, any hurdles they face (like missing resources), and what they need from others to move forward. This collaborative effort maximizes their efficiency and helps the group succeed.

Explain system features and benefits in simplified terms.
Client demos are focused on presenting the features and benefits of a system in a way that's understandable to non-technical audiences. Simplifying complex language and using relatable terms ensures that clients see the value in what is being presented. Engaging in dialogue and checking for understanding helps to bridge the gap between technical specifications and client expectations.
Think of a car salesperson showcasing a new vehicle to a potential buyer. Instead of bombarding the buyer with technical specifications, the salesperson highlights how features like fuel efficiency and safety enhancements make driving easier and safer. This helps the buyer understand the value without getting lost in technical jargon.

Practice active listening, clear articulation, and structured explanations.
Successful oral communication involves not just speaking but also listening actively. This means paying attention, understanding, responding, and remembering what others say. In addition, clear articulation of thoughts and structured explanations help ensure that messages are conveyed effectively. This composite skill set enhances the overall effectiveness of communication in any engineering context.
Think of a good friend listening to you recount a complicated story. They nod, ask follow-up questions, and clarify points to ensure they really understand. By actively participating in the conversation, they make it clear you are both engaged and interested in what is being discussed. This same concept applies to effective communication during professional discussions.
